    I have the Linx7 and could defo recommend them as a great budget tablet. The 7" can be got for £50 when there are deals going. Granted though it's small so only really for videos (incl Netflix), very basic games and internet. Dunno how much homework you'd get done on a 7/8/9" tablet though.... With your budget I'd have thought you'd manage to get a Linx 10" or other W10 tablet

    Yeah I run Windows 10 on mine. To be honest I mainly use it for browsing, watching video files or simple games. Advantage of something this size is that it'll fit in a big jacket pocket if you wanted it on the bus/train. Another handy thing is I brought it away before and was able to download photos we had taken of an event and show them to other people on the screen.
